Ex-RAB officer Tarek admits to N’ganj killing

The court has sent Ex-RAB officer Tarek Sayeed Mohammad to jail after recording his statement

Former official of Rapid Action Battalion (RAB) Tarek Sayeed Mohammad has confessed of his involvement with the Narayanganj seven murders incident on Wednesday.

The court of Narayanganj Senior Judicial Magistrate KM Mohiuddin recorded his confessional statement under section 164 around 12noon.

District Lawyers’ Association President Sakhawat Hossain confirmed to the Dhaka Tribune about Tarek’s confession.

The former RAB official was brought to the court premises around 8am and took four hours to take the final decision, said Sakhawat.

After recording his statement, the court sent him to jail.

Earlier, Maj (retd) Arif Hossain and former RAB-officer Lt Commander MM Rana confessed of their involvements with the seven murders in Narayanganj.

Narayanganj City Corporation panel mayor Nazrul Islam and lawyer Chandan Sarkar along with five others were killed and their bodies were dumped into River Shitalakkhya after they were abducted on April 27.

The family members of Nazrul alleged that RAB 11 Commanding Officer Lt Col Tareq Sayeed Mohammad and two other RAB 11 officials–Major Arif Hossain and Lt Commander SM Masud Rana–killed all the seven persons for Tk6 crore.

On April 28, the authorities concerned had withdrawn all the three RAB-11 officials along with the Narayanganj superintendent of police and the deputy commissioner.

Following the allegations, the AFD sent Lt Col Tareq Sayeed Mohammad and Major Rana on premature retirement from the Army and Lt Commander SM Masud Rana on forced retirement from the Navy.
